2015-01-08 192 views
-1

我試圖將用戶重定向到page2.php並添加$hash到URL添加變量到URL下頁用PHP

我目前使用:

header("Location: page2.php?". $_SERVER['QUERY_STRING']); 

其作品,但之後在$_SERVER['QUERY_STRING']我想補充&when=$hash到URL

$hash定義,我只是需要它來傳遞到下一個頁面

+3

好,那麼什麼是日問題? –

回答

4

只需在連接字符串:

header("Location: page2.php?". $_SERVER['QUERY_STRING'] . "&when=" . $hash); 
0

您可以設置散列值的會話重定向之前,然後做你現在正在做的ridirect或URL

隨着會議

嵌入它
$_SESSION['when'] = $hash; 
header("Location: page2.php?". $_SERVER['QUERY_STRING']); 

直接嵌入在URL

header("Location: page2.php?".$_SERVER['QUERY_STRING']."&when=".$hash); 
+0

請檢查您的答案。當「]' – vaso123

+0

錯誤時,您不會使用'$ _ SESSION [」],但爲什麼不應該使用? –

+0

對不起,我的錯。我認爲這兩種替代方法是相互關聯的。 – vaso123